To the Worlds Largest live every. The greatest and most extensive Cultural Institution on the planet. The nations very own, your very own library of congress. Founded in 1800, not long after the founding of this country. It was conceived as a place that would furnish congress and the American Government with the information and need as it carried out duties of representing all of us. Initially the library was housed in the u. S. Capitol which sits across the street from here. In 1813, the british army invaded washington and the Capital Building caught fire. It was engulfed in the flames. All the libraries books were burned to ashes. A few months ago, tanisha handed me a book and it like she and i book recommendations. This is kind of a regular thing. But this is the first time one of us had actually, like, bought a book and handed it to other person. And that book was invisible child by andrea elliott. And tunisia is very much this books evangelist in a marvel of immersive journalism, eliot followed the daily plight of a homeless family to parents and eight children in new york city. In fact, she practically became part of the family, all by embedding herself with them for eight years at the heart, the story is dasani the eldest daughter, a young teen full of personality, charm and moxie.
